#26d516 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#26d516 is composed of 14.9% red, 83.5% green and 8.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 89.7%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 115 degrees, a saturation of 81.3% and a lightness of 46.1%. #26d516 color hex could be obtained by blending #4cff2c with #00ab00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c00.

Shades and Tints of #26d516

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#031102 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#26d516

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#717b70 is the less saturated color, while #17e704 is the most saturated one.
